    Default having a small problems running 2 windows

    So i am trying to single box 2 window my priest and my lock using keyclone and having quite a few minor annoying issues. I am just wondering if anyone has experiance/ has any suggestions.

    1) Dropping /follow and having to go back and "pick up" the offending caracter this is especially bad on epic land mounts

    2) on the 2nd toon movement interfearing w/ casting litterally i am having to stop and stand still for 1 sec to make sure the 2nd toon is not moving then start the spell w/ cast time ...(range issues as well but that is my learning curve)

    3) dropped key strokes to 2nd window .....or so it seems....hit 2 and pain goes up fine but corrup doesn't (making sure range isn't a issue and it is a instant cast so..... meh )



    ****finding out that a shadow priest and a lock are not as good of a match as i originally had hoped :? i may respec the priest to holy and just make him a healbot. Prob w/ that is that it really doesnt speed me up any because the lock already has 0 down time when grinding.

    as for 1 and 2, I dont think there is any way to fix it, you gonna deal with it

    for 3: it happens because of ping (o'rly?). I assume you use /assist while casting spells on your alt. Basicaly when you press a button your second character requests information about which target does your main target. Before that ofc your main must send info about his target to server.

    main's taret ==> server ==> 2nd character

    it takes some time for your 2nd char to "understand" that your main changed target

    only way to fix it is to target something and wait 1 sec before using spells at alt.

    yep you should slow down and learn to target right targets at right time :P will come later with multiboxing experience

    And not really, 5-boxers prefer insta casts only because they insta kill most targets or inflict heavy injures.

    I have /assist in macros with spells, so no, thats not the problem.

    I use /assist in separate keybind only when my warlocks cast drain life/mana and I need to change their target without interrupting spellcasting. Otherwise it seems pretty useless.
